蜘蛛池数据开发,旨在探索互联网数据的新边疆,为数据科学家、网络工程师和研究者们提供一个全新的平台。蜘蛛池论坛则是一个专注于数据开发、数据挖掘和数据科学研究的社区,汇聚了众多行业专家和爱好者,共同分享经验、交流心得,推动数据科学的发展。通过蜘蛛池,用户可以轻松获取各种互联网数据资源,包括网页、图片、视频等,为数据分析和研究提供有力支持。蜘蛛池也致力于保护用户隐私和数据安全,确保用户在使用过程中的信息安全。
在数字化时代,数据已成为企业决策、市场分析和科学研究的重要资源,而蜘蛛池数据开发,作为一种新兴的互联网数据采集技术,正逐步成为企业获取高质量数据的关键手段,本文将深入探讨蜘蛛池数据开发的原理、应用、优势以及面临的挑战,并展望其未来的发展趋势。
一、蜘蛛池数据开发的原理
蜘蛛池数据开发的核心在于利用多个网络爬虫(Spider)同时工作,以实现对互联网数据的全面、高效采集,每个爬虫都相当于一个“数据猎人”,在网页间穿梭,抓取所需信息,通过构建爬虫池,可以实现对多个目标网站的并行采集,从而大幅提高数据采集的效率和规模。
1、爬虫设计:需要设计高效的爬虫程序,能够准确识别并提取目标网站的数据,这包括网页解析、数据抽取、存储和传输等多个环节。
2、分布式部署:将多个爬虫部署在不同的服务器上,形成爬虫池,这样不仅可以提高采集效率,还能有效分散风险,防止单个爬虫被封禁或崩溃影响整个采集任务。
3、智能调度:通过智能调度系统,根据目标网站的访问压力、爬虫的性能等因素,动态调整爬虫的工作负载,实现资源的优化配置。
二、蜘蛛池数据开发的应用
蜘蛛池数据开发在多个领域都有广泛的应用,以下是一些主要的应用场景:
1、市场研究:通过抓取电商网站、社交媒体等平台的用户评论、销售数据等,帮助企业了解市场需求、竞争对手情况和消费者行为,为市场策略制定提供有力支持。
2、金融分析:在金融领域,蜘蛛池可以抓取股票行情、新闻公告、财报数据等,为投资者提供及时、全面的信息支持,提高投资决策的准确性。
3、舆情监测:通过抓取新闻网站、论坛、微博等社交平台的信息,实时监测舆论动态,为企业危机公关提供预警和决策依据。
4、学术科研:在科研领域,蜘蛛池可以抓取学术论文、专利数据等,为科研人员提供丰富的学术资源,加速科研进程。
三、蜘蛛池数据开发的优势
与传统的数据采集方法相比,蜘蛛池数据开发具有以下显著优势:
1、高效性:通过并行采集和智能调度,蜘蛛池能够大幅提高数据采集的效率和规模,满足大规模数据采集的需求。
2、灵活性:蜘蛛池可以灵活调整采集策略,根据目标网站的变化和采集需求的变化进行实时调整。
3、稳定性:分布式部署和冗余设计使得蜘蛛池具有较高的稳定性和可靠性,即使单个节点出现问题也不会影响整个采集任务。
4、低成本:相比雇佣专业调查机构或购买第三方数据服务,蜘蛛池数据开发具有较低的成本优势。
四、面临的挑战与应对策略
尽管蜘蛛池数据开发具有诸多优势,但在实际应用中仍面临一些挑战和问题:
1、法律风险:数据采集必须遵守相关法律法规,如隐私法、版权法等,在采集过程中要尊重网站的使用条款和隐私政策,避免侵犯用户隐私和权益,应对策略是加强法律合规意识,建立完善的法律合规体系。
2、技术挑战:随着网站反爬虫技术的不断升级,爬虫需要不断适应新的反爬策略,应对策略是持续投入研发力量,提升爬虫技术的智能化和自动化水平。
3、数据安全:采集到的数据需要妥善存储和传输,防止数据泄露和丢失,应对策略是采用先进的数据加密技术和安全存储方案。
4、数据质量:由于互联网数据的多样性和复杂性,采集到的数据中可能存在大量噪声和重复数据,应对策略是采用数据清洗和去重技术,提高数据的质量。
五、未来发展趋势与展望
随着人工智能、大数据等技术的不断发展,蜘蛛池数据开发将迎来更多的机遇和挑战,未来可能的发展趋势包括:
1、智能化:结合人工智能技术,实现爬虫的自主学习和智能调整,提高数据采集的效率和准确性,通过自然语言处理和机器学习技术,实现网页内容的自动解析和提取。
2、云端化:将爬虫部署在云端服务器上,实现资源的弹性扩展和按需使用,这不仅可以降低硬件成本,还可以提高数据采集的灵活性和可扩展性。
3、生态化:构建数据采集、存储、分析、应用等全链条的生态系统,实现数据的价值最大化,与数据分析平台、数据挖掘工具等集成,提供一站式的数据服务解决方案。
4、合规化:随着法律法规的不断完善和用户隐私保护意识的提高,数据采集将更加注重合规性和合法性,未来可能出台更多的行业标准和规范来指导数据采集行为。
蜘蛛池数据开发作为一种新兴的数据采集技术正在逐步改变着我们的数据采集方式和生活方式,未来随着技术的不断进步和应用场景的不断拓展它将在更多领域发挥重要作用并推动互联网数据的全面发展。